Highcalcium limestone is used to make Portland cement that is used in concrete and mortars. Portland cement is produced by burning a slurry of finely crushed, highcalcium limestone, clay, sand, and a small amount of iron ore in a cement kiln. The pelletal material exiting the kiln is called "clinker.

In the manufacture of Portland cement, clinker occurs as lumps or nodules, usually 3 millimetres ( in) to 25 millimetres ( in) in diameter, produced by sintering (fusing together without melting to the point of liquefaction) limestone and aluminosilicate materials such as clay during the cement kiln stage.

Grain size (or particle size) is the diameter of individual grains of sediment, or the lithified particles in clastic rocks. The term may also be applied to other granular materials. This is different from the crystallite size, which refers to the size of a single crystal inside a particle or grain.

mudstone: sedimentary rocks made of clay and/or silt shale: mudstone that is fissile (splits apart easily into layers) sandstone: sand sized grains; quartz sandstone (made mostly of quartz), arkose (made mostly of feldspar grains), lithic sandstone (made mostly of rock fragments), wacke (made of a mixture of sand sized and mud sized grains)

Concrete is a hardened material that forms when a mixture of cement, sand, crushed stone and water is poured into moulds or formwork and allowed to cure or harden. Cement is made by strongly heating a mixture of limestone, silica and clay in a kiln until small peasized lumps called ''clinker'' form.

Coquina is a type of porous limestone that is chiefly composed of fossil debris. Width of view 40 cm. Ooid sand from Abu Dhabi, The United Arab Emirates. The width of the view is mm. Oolite is a lithified ooid sand. Glauconitic limestone from Estonia (Ordovician). Limestone with a significant amount of clay minerals is known as marl.
